About the job
The company Geser-ALPINA GmbH was founded in 2012. From the beginning, the customer and their needs have been the top priority. Through competent advice and good service, the company has been able to grow over the past years. The services are mainly provided in the areas of production and processing for the butcher trade as well as the food industry.
Service Technician (m/f)
Area: Entire Switzerland / Location: Flawil SG
Your main tasks are:
- Repair and maintenance of machines and equipment
- Assembly and commissioning of machines
- Production support
- Customer care and customer advice
Important requirements are:
- Training as a mechanic or agricultural machinery mechanic with good basic electrical knowledge
- Independent working style
- Customer-oriented and optimistic personality
- Driver's license category B, category BE (trailer) is an advantage
- Willingness for on-call duty
- Willingness to travel and provide services
- French language skills are an advantage
What to expect:
- Responsible and varied activity where you can apply and deepen your knowledge in the areas of mechanics, electrical engineering, hydraulics, and pneumatics
- Attractive employment conditions, fair remuneration, good social benefits, and a well-equipped service vehicle
- Thorough training
- Location close to Flawil train station
- Motivated team
